Output 633c55d49dda563d6a4c996f9cf8f7fe87d24bdf42f76b37ef646bdda189a89e:1

value
8621587
script pubkey
OP_0 OP_PUSHBYTES_20 d1ad7e52b45a1dbc0e16dfafb8a2357ec6463884
address
bc1q6xkhu545tgwmcrskm7hm3g340mryvwyye2qrk8
transaction
633c55d49dda563d6a4c996f9cf8f7fe87d24bdf42f76b37ef646bdda189a89e
confirmations
261891
spent
true